What it is
D-ID is an Israeli AI company that specialises in making still photos speak — a technology called “talking avatars” or “talking heads.” You provide a photo of a person (or an AI-generated portrait) and a script (or audio), and D-ID animates the face to appear to be speaking.
Key difference from HeyGen and Synthesia:
- HeyGen / Synthesia: 3D-rendered AI avatars or full video clones
- D-ID: Animating existing photographs — making a real photo “come to life” by adding realistic mouth movements, subtle head movements, and blinking
D-ID products:
- Creative Reality Studio: The main product — animate photos to speak; choose from stock faces or upload your own portrait photo
- Agents: AI avatar chatbots for customer interaction — the talking face speaks in real time in response to customer questions
- API: Enterprise integration for automating talking avatar video generation
What you can do:
- Upload a portrait photo + type text → D-ID makes the person in the photo appear to speak
- Upload a portrait + upload audio → face animates to match the audio
- Create talking avatar chatbots for websites and apps
- Translate and re-lip-sync existing videos (dub into other languages)
What you’d use it for
- Marketing: Animate a product photo or brand spokesperson image
- Education: Create talking character explainers from illustrated characters
- Corporate comms: Quickly create a “talking” version of a CEO photo for a company announcement
- Historical figures: Animate historical photographs for education (museum exhibits, educational content)
- Customer service chatbots: Add a face to your chatbot for more human-feeling interaction
- Personalised video messages: Send personalised “talking” avatar messages at scale

How it compares to HeyGen and Synthesia
| Aspect | D-ID | HeyGen | Synthesia |
|---|---|---|---|
| Core strength | Animate photos | Avatar video generation | Enterprise avatar video |
| Price | Lowest | Mid | Mid-High |
| Enterprise focus | Moderate | Good | Strong |
| Custom avatar | From photos | From video | Enterprise only |
| Language support | 100+ | 40+ | 140+ |
| Best for | Budget; photo animation; chatbots | SMB; creators | Large enterprise |
D-ID’s niche: the cheapest way to create talking avatar content, especially if you have portrait photos you want to animate.
Privacy / data handling
- Israeli company; GDPR compliant; SOC 2 Type II
- Data hosted on AWS
- Photos and scripts processed to generate videos; not used to train D-ID’s models on paid plans
- The Agents product (chatbot) processes user conversations in real-time
Ethical use requirements:
- D-ID requires consent for animating real people’s photos
- Using D-ID to create non-consensual content of real people violates their terms
- Content policy prohibits deceptive use, political manipulation, or adult content
Gotchas
- The photo quality is critical. A blurry, low-resolution, or poorly-lit portrait will produce poor results. Use a high-quality, front-facing portrait with good lighting.
- Extreme head angles don’t work. The photo should be relatively straight-on — extreme profile shots or very angled faces don’t animate well.
- AI-generated portraits work well. If you want a digital character without using a real person’s face, generate a portrait with Midjourney or DALL·E and use that — it animates cleanly.
- Longer scripts drift. For long videos (2+ minutes), the quality of the lip sync can deteriorate. Break long content into multiple shorter clips.
- The chatbot (Agents) product requires development integration. It’s not plug-and-play — it requires embedding in your website or app via API.
